    So I signed up, picked a product that I thought might appeal to my viewers and got their banner and my affiliate link. Through some miracle I managed to figure out how to embed my link into the banner and to load the banner onto my site ... I did say was a noob here !

    Here is the question ... how do I track the ad ? How do i track clicks ? All the clickbank account info seems prepared to tell me is how many sales I have made which is pretty weak info if I dont know how many clicks the banner is getting ???

    Any advice on this or any other techniques that I could be incorporating would be appreciated.

    Either that, or you make the banner re-direct to a link on your site

    which then re-directs to the clickbank product with your affiliate link

    that way you can just check your stats to see how many clicks you get
